Desde la aparición de la célebre obra de Hobsbawm, "Rebeldes primitivos", se multiplicaron los estudios sobre el bandolerismo en América Latina. Considerando el aporte de dichos estudios, nos proponemos cuestionar la teoría de Hobsbawm acerca del bandolerismo como un movimiento pre-político, a través del estudio de caso de las acciones colectivas emprendidas por la guerrilla de Vallegrande, comandada por Juan Antonio Álvarez de Arenales, en la Gobernación de Cochabamba entre 1814-1816, haciendo énfasis fundamentalmente en la guerra de recursos que desarrollaron las parcialidades indígenas de la región. A través del análisis de la documentación, sostenemos que las acciones colectivas emprendidas por lo grupos indígenas de la región fueron premeditadas y asumieron características políticas a lo largo de la guerra. description Since the advent of Hobsbawm's famous "Primitive Rebels," there has been a proliferation of studies on banditry in Latin America. Considering the contribution of these studies, we propose to question Hobsbawm's theory of banditry as a pre-political movement, through the case study of the collective actions undertaken by the Vallegrande guerrillas, commanded by Juan Antonio Álvarez de Arenales, in The Governor of Cochabamba between 1814-1816, emphasizing fundamentally the war of resources that developed the indigenous bias of the region. Through the analysis of the documentation, we maintain that the collective actions undertaken by the indigenous groups of the region were premeditated and assumed political characteristics throughout the war.
